#bce920 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bce920 is composed of 73.7% red, 91.4%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 73.4 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 52%. #bce920 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#79d300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#bce920 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bce920 has RGB values of R:188, G:233,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12380448.

Hex triplet bce920 #bce920
RGB Decimal 188, 233, 32 rgb(188,233,32)
RGB Percent 73.7, 91.4, 12.5 rgb(73.7%,91.4%,12.5%)
CMYK 19, 0, 86, 9
HSL 73.4°, 82, 52 hsl(73.4,82%,52%)
HSV (or HSB) 73.4°, 86.3, 91.4
Web Safe ccff33 #ccff33
CIE-LAB 86.54, -37.985, 80.751
XYZ 50.138, 69.073, 12.057
xyY 0.382, 0.526, 69.073
CIE-LCH 86.54, 89.239, 115.192
CIE-LUV 86.54, -21.554, 96.217
Hunter-Lab 83.11, -37.758, 49.575
Binary 10111100, 11101001, 00100000

Shades and Tints of #bce920

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070901 is the darkest color, while #fcf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bce920

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888b7e is the less saturated color, while #c6fc0d is the most saturated one.
